Page 17: ...TU mode message frames are distinguished by idle intervals of at least 3 5 character times which are called t3 5 in subsequent sections Figure 5 RTU message frame The entire message frame must be sent in a continuous character stream When the pause time interval between two characters exceeds 1 5 characters the information frame is considered incomplete and the receiver does not receive the inform...
